'A Connected Line'
Jess Frederick 

I am fascinated by what we can know in a gaze, how connection is silently communicated and privately understood by the viewer. I am interested in the complex characters of living beings and the connections we share with the world around us. I want to visually articulate the unspoken yet meaningful exchanges between all living and nonliving things.   

My work frequently showcases subjects whose outward stare or postural gestures engage the viewer in an off-kilter way, emphasizing the unsettled wonder of these non-verbal exchanges. They can suggest glimpses of empathy, tension, and calm.  

In my work I want to illuminate these ephemeral exchanges without imposing control, offering the viewer opportunities for pause, contemplation, imagination, and most importantly connection. For me, this is the most remarkable gift of art.

By leaning in to the uncertainty of these exchanges, we open ourselves up to an opportunity to reflection, introspection, and understanding.  

As a self-taught artist, I take pride in blurring the lines between paintings and drawings. I love line and the psychological power of marks. I work in acrylic, charcoal, pastel, ink, and cut paper. I don’t make preliminary studies: I begin with an idea and immediately move to express it. I enjoy the ability of these continuous adjustments to surprise. I layer a web of energetic lines from which the essence of my subjects emerges. I often use hot water to then deface the surface and reveal ghosts of underpainting. Then, I simplify and focus the forms and enhance the details. The end is a layered work poised between chaos and calm.

- Jess Frederick
